T84.293A
ICD-10-CMOther mechanical complication of internal fixation device of bones of foot and toes, initial encounter
This code signifies a mechanical issue with an internal fixation device, such as a plate, screw, or rod, that was surgically implanted to stabilize a fracture or perform an osteotomy in the bones of the foot or toes. This complication is not a fracture of the device itself, but rather another type of mechanical problem like loosening, displacement, or breakage of a component, occurring during the initial phase of treatment.
Apply this code when a patient presents with a new or acute mechanical complication related to an internal fixation device in their foot or toes. This includes situations where the device has shifted, become loose, or a part has broken, requiring evaluation or intervention. It is appropriate for the initial encounter for this specific complication.
